The YSR Congress party on Wednesday reiterated that it would not allow the State Legislative Assembly to function till it passes a resolution in favour of united Andhra Pradesh.
Speaking to media persons, YSR Congress party MLA Bhumana Karunakar Reddy said the party had specifically placed its demand during the meeting of Business Advisory Committee (BAC) and would insist on passing of resolution in the House in favour of united Andhra Pradesh.
He claimed that overall development of all regions was possible only through united State.
Karunakar Reddy described Chief Minister N Kiran Kumar Reddy and TDP president N Chandrababu Naidu as betrayers of Andhra Pradesh and said that they were hand-in-glove with the process of State's division.
